Настройка xDebug на PhpStorm + OpenServer

Обсуждение других вопросов связанных с веб-разработкой
Spleshka
Сообщения: 7
Зарегистрирован:
14 фев 2012, 12:13

Настройка xDebug на PhpStorm + OpenServer

Spleshka » 14 фев 2012, 12:16

Всем доброго времени суток.

Вчера очень долго промучался, настраивая отладчик xDebug в PhpStorm'e в связке с OpenServer'ом. Поэтому хочу поделиться информацией со всеми. Более подробно и со скриншотами информацию можно почитать тут: http://drupalace.ru/lesson/nastroyka-ot ... pen-server.

Спасибо.
Bueno
Сообщения: 83
Зарегистрирован:
01 фев 2012, 12:55

Re: Настройка xDebug на PhpStorm + OpenServer

Bueno » 14 фев 2012, 14:03

простите, а чем это отличается от официального руководства?..
http://blog.jetbrains.com/webide/2011/0 ... storm-2-0/
Spleshka
Сообщения: 7
Зарегистрирован:
14 фев 2012, 12:13

Re: Настройка xDebug на PhpStorm + OpenServer

Spleshka » 15 фев 2012, 01:10

Во первых, убрана лишняя информация по настройке, которой место действительно в документации.
Во вторых, добавлена пошаговая инструкция действий с Open Server'ом. Не каждый ведь знает "куда нажать, чтоб было весело".
Ну и в третьих - мануал на русском языке. Не каждый разработчик способен легко читать документацию на англ. языке. Да и если есть выбор между рускоязычным и англоязычным мануалом, лично я всегда предпочитаю читать на родном языке.
Bueno
Сообщения: 83
Зарегистрирован:
01 фев 2012, 12:55

Re: Настройка xDebug на PhpStorm + OpenServer

Bueno » 15 фев 2012, 11:41

а вот мне думается, что не на оф.сайте "лишнее", а у вас описание в духе "ассемблер за 24 часа".. например зачем ставить галочку "галочку Use path mapping" из вашего опуса решительно не понятно, тогда как в оф.документе все разжевано до нежной кашицы..

ну и, раз уж мы в оффтопе, имхо программер просто обязан не только знать, но и понимать что он делает, и без хотя бы базового английского (который делает прочтение манов занятием легким и непринужденным) в программировании делать просто нечего, ибо превращает это занятие в мудовые страдания и плодит быдлокодеров.. как то так..

резюмируя, имею основание считать вашу статью скорее вредной, чем полезной..
Аватара пользователя
Максим
Сообщения: 5383
Зарегистрирован:
11 дек 2010, 20:29
Контактная информация:

Re: Настройка xDebug на PhpStorm + OpenServer

Максим » 15 фев 2012, 11:48

Ну написал человек инструкцию, ну спасибо ему. Все довольны. Не нравится, не используйте, никто же не заставляет.
Spleshka
Сообщения: 7
Зарегистрирован:
14 фев 2012, 12:13

Re: Настройка xDebug на PhpStorm + OpenServer

Spleshka » 15 фев 2012, 13:32

Bueno,

В описанном вами случае вообще ничего не нужно писать или делать для людей, так как любой уважающий себя веб разработчик должен уметь всё делать с нуля, читать тонны мануалов на англицком, сам собирать веб серверы под себя, не использовать стандартные функции PHP, а писать свои - а то ведь он может не знать что они написаны на С, и не читать исходники, в таком случае язык программирования вообще вредный.

Вместо того, чтобы докапываться до чужих работ - сделайте что-то своё и покажите как надо, а то мы не умеем ;)

Максим - ещё раз спасибо за Open Server. Прекрасная сборка.
Bueno
Сообщения: 83
Зарегистрирован:
01 фев 2012, 12:55

Re: Настройка xDebug на PhpStorm + OpenServer

Bueno » 15 фев 2012, 13:54

В описанном вами случае вообще ничего не нужно писать или делать для людей
а не покажите, в каком месте я это заявил?.. правильный вывод из моего заявления - дополнить свою стать соответствующим материалом, вы не находите?..
так как любой уважающий себя веб разработчик должен уметь всё делать с нуля
а каждый человек с момента рождения умеет бегать и решать дифуры.. т.е. еще один бредовый вывод..
читать тонны мануалов на англицком, сам собирать веб серверы под себя
естественно.. без этого никак.. иначе делетантство.. и не только на шекспировскм, сейчас и на русский апереведено уже не мало литературы.. но далеко не все, посему английский нужен как воздух..
не использовать стандартные функции PHP, а писать свои - а то ведь он может не знать что они написаны на С, и не читать исходники, в таком случае язык программирования вообще вредный
пожалуйста, потрудитесь найти в моем посте этот маразм и процитируйте..
Вместо того, чтобы докапываться до чужих работ
см. первый пункт..
сделайте что-то своё и покажите как надо
признаюсь честно - я хреново умею объяснять.. именно поэтому, например, в комманде в которой я работаю, разьясняю все на конкретных примерах и реальном коде.. и да - не пишу статей, т.к. считаю что лучше не пудрить людям мозг своими полуобъяснялками вовсе, но помогать решать конкретные задачи (вот тут с полными выкладками)..
Spleshka
Сообщения: 7
Зарегистрирован:
14 фев 2012, 12:13

Re: Настройка xDebug на PhpStorm + OpenServer

Spleshka » 15 фев 2012, 15:45

Я лишь развил вашу мысль по поводу "разработчик должен". В моей статье есть ссылка на документацию, пройдя по которой, можно почитать об отладке из официального источника.

Простите, но вступать в холивары и что-то доказывать я не хочу. Если бы все считали, что надо досканально изучать каждую мелочь, даже мало связанную с основным видом деятельности, то мы бы с вами сейчас били палками по стенам и охотились на кабанов. Не стоит забывать, что Интернет даёт людям доступ к быстрой информации. Если мне понадобится что-то изучить досканально - я открою мануал. Если я хочу просто настроить отладчик и мне не важно, как он работает изнутри - я прочту вот такую "вредную" статью и настрою его за 5 минут.
Bueno
Сообщения: 83
Зарегистрирован:
01 фев 2012, 12:55

Re: Настройка xDebug на PhpStorm + OpenServer

Bueno » 15 фев 2012, 16:31

Я лишь развил вашу мысль
прошу прошения, но мою мысль вы не только не развили, но даже не удосужились хотя бы попробовать понять.. зато не поленились написать ужасающий бред и присвоить его мне..

что до конкретного случая.. коли человек почувствовал необходимость глубокого дебага своего приложения, значит он уже далеко за пределами "hallo world!", и залез достаточно глубоко, что бы выйти за уровень тупого копипаста.. однако ваша статья говорит "не думай никуя, сделай как на картинке, нахрена тебе знать с кем еще спит твоя жена - главное же что спит с тобой".. и не надо быть семипядием, что бы понять чему подобное приводит.. за последний месяц в своей компании проинтервьюировал ококо 30 соискателей.. не поверите - никого не смогли взять, просто трындец како-то - сплошная школота (хотя зп более чем).. и мне, просто по человечески обидно за авторитет професии и уровень зарплат, лихо сбиваемые быдлокодерами-недоучками.. вы же - очередной простимулировали данную публику.. вот я и взъелся.. и считаю что справедливо.. *уходит махать флагом )))*

я прочту вот такую "вредную" статью и настрою его за 5 минут
ну да.. а потом выучите си за 24 часа, пойдете работать разработчиком ПО для мед.оборудования и угробите сотни людей.. а чо, подумаешь, зато как быстро профи стал, куле..
Spleshka
Сообщения: 7
Зарегистрирован:
14 фев 2012, 12:13

Re: Настройка xDebug на PhpStorm + OpenServer

Spleshka » 15 фев 2012, 22:46

Скажите, вы когда покупаете хлеб в магазине, то узнаёте как зовут всех продавцов в магазине, директора, пекаря, по каким технологиям пекли хлеб, сколько грамм муки потратили именно на вашу буханку, а сколько тратят обычно, почему хлеб с коричневым оттенком, хотя вроде должен быть темнее, на какой машине его везли в магазин, и не наркоман ли водитель, который этот хлеб привёз в магазин? Если да - то претензий к вам нет.

Я вам пытаюсь донести простую истину. Я никоим образом не поощряю школоло-самоучек, которые постоянно лезут во все щели и за которыми постоянно всё приходится переделывать. Но вы должны отличать: я не занимаюсь профессиональной настройкой отладчиков. Я программист. И свои знания как программист я черпал из официальных источников. Но мне абсолютно без разницы, почему я должен поставить галочку напротив "Use path mapping", чтобы отладчик работал. В своей области я изучаю всё, начиная с истоков, однако сопутствующие технологии, о которых заказчик даже не подозревает, я абсолютно не обязан знать досконально.
Ответить